Final GB Women’s Roster Announced

Head Coach Tom Maher has selected his final roster for the GB Senior Women’s Eurobasket qualifying campaign this August.

There has been two new faces added to the final roster, which has seen Rosalee Mason and Stephanie Gandy get cut. Guard Natalie Stafford who plays for Barking Abbey Leopards and Rachael Vanderwal who currently plays for UL Basketball Club in the Irish Super League are the new additions.

Maher, talking about the losses and new additions, said:

“It has been extremely difficult to select the final 14 players who will see us through the test games against Portugal, Belgium, Holland and Israel and the EuroBasket Qualifying campaign. I would like to thank Rosalee and Stephanie for their commitment to the GB cause this summer, but a couple of players had to miss out. We think we have selected a balanced roster in terms of experience and youth whilst also ensuring we have good cover in all positions.

We welcome Natalie and Rachael to the Standard Life GB team. They have been on our radar for a while and we feel now is the correct time to introduce them to the roster.”

GB Senior Women’s Final Roster

Anderson, Rose – Scotland & University Central Oklahoma, USA

Butler, Kimberly – England & Panionios, Greece

Clayden, Joanna – England & Leeds Carnegie, EBL

Collins, Stefanie – England & UWIC Archers, EBL

Handy, Chantelle – England & Marshall University, USA

Hoffman, Meagan – England & UWIC Archers, EBL

Hutchinson, Lisa – England & City of Sheffield Hatters, EBL

Leedham, Johannah – England & Franklin Pierce University, USA

McKay, Sarah – England & Unattached

Page, Julie – England & Pays d’Aix Basket 13, FRA

Stafford, Natalie – England & Barking Abbey Leopards, EBL

Stewart, Azania – England & Florida University, USA

Wade-Fray, Jeneya – England & University of Tennessee at Chattanooga, USA

Vanderwal, Rachael – England & UL Basketball Club, IRE
